This walking tour is a celebration of the heart of Bristol - the Harbourside.

Your experience starts in Queen Square where you’ll meet your history-loving host, Anna. As you venture along the waterways, Anna will reveal the fascinating history of the Harbourside and its importance in the development of Bristol as one of Britain's leading port cities. You’ll discover how the floating harbour was created and marvel at the engineering masterpieces that have stood the test of time, still dominating the Bristol cityscape.

Although the Harbourside may no longer be the commercial trading hub it once was, you’ll see how it has been adapted to suit the modern-day Bristolian, with leisure activities galore. This experience truly celebrates both the vibrancy of the city and the maritime heritage of Bristol.

Anna’s passion for history and her love of Bristol are sure to have rubbed off on you by the time you finish your walk near Underfall Yard.
